http://chinatownconnection.com/sesame-seed-balls-recipe.htm WebIngredients for Our Chinese Sesame Balls Recipe 200g red bean paste or lotus paste, divided into 10g balls 45g wheat starch 90mL boiling water 120g glutinous rice flour 45g sugar 85-90 mL room temperature water 45g lard 1 tsp water 100g white sesame seeds Step by Step Instructions for Our Fried Sesame Ball Recipe
